Here are some tips to help you organize a successful homemade Easter egg hunt:
- Choose a Location: Select a safe and spacious area, whether it's your backyard, a local park, or even indoors. Ensure the space is suitable for children to explore.
- Prepare the Eggs: Use plastic eggs that can be filled with treats. You can include candy, small toys, or even stuffed toys as special surprises!
- Set a Theme: Consider a theme for your hunt, such as a favorite cartoon character or color scheme, to make it more exciting.
- Age Appropriateness: Tailor the difficulty of the hunt based on the age of the participants. Younger children may need eggs hidden in easier spots, while older kids can handle a more challenging search.
- Incorporate Games: Add games or challenges to the hunt, such as riddles or clues, to enhance the experience.
